Premium Features Sell collections & albums Includes a shopping cart for selling multiple products at once Secure Audio Playback Filter products by file types Sell products exclusively with licenses Create & apply discounts, coupons Import multiple audio files with ID3 tag extraction Integrate with WebHooks, Salesforce Generate & send dynamic coupons for promotions Demo of Premium Version of Plugin http://demos.dwbooster.com/music-store/wp-login.php http://demos.dwbooster.com/music-store/ Are the download links secure? Access to song files in the WordPress store is safeguarded: Files are stored in a protected directory, accessible only through server-side validation. The Music Store plugin validates download links based on purchase date, download limit, and email verification. Settings allow defining link validity period, download limits, and email verification for secure access to purchased songs. Interface Setting up Music Store Music Store – WordPress ecommerce can be set up via the menu: “Settings / Music Store” or the new submenu “Music Store / Store Settings”. The setup screen offers general settings for the Music Store, allows to enter PayPal data to process sales (The plugin includes the integration with other payment gateways like Square Up, iDeal – Mollie, and Stripe), and texts necessary for email notifications. Settings Interface The setup interface offers: Integration with WooCommerce: Sell products via WooCommerce cart. Music Store URL: Define the store’s webpage URL for seamless navigation. Filter options: Filter products by type, genre, artist, or album. Pagination: Enable multiple pages for music store products. Friendly URLs: Use user-friendly URLs for product pages. Layout selection: Choose from various store layouts. Items per page: Set the number of products displayed per page. Player customization: Select audio player style. Secure playback settings: Control protected playback percentage and explanatory text. Social sharing: Include social sharing buttons for songs and collections. Payment Gateway Settings Enable PayPal Payments to facilitate product sales through PayPal. You can enter PayPal email, currency, and PayPal interface language by default. Payment Button: Choose the design for payment buttons. Use Shopping Cart: Activate a shopping cart for consolidated purchases. Hide Download Link for Blank Prices: Conceal download links for songs with blank prices. Enhance Download Page Security: Verify the email used for product purchase on the download page. Bundle Purchased Files: Download all files as a single ZIP file for convenience. Restrict Access to Registered Users: Display “Buy Now” buttons and download links for registered users only. Licenses: Enter URLs for licenses related to free, regular, and exclusive purchases. Discount Settings (Advanced Version) Display Promotions: Showcase discount offers on the music store page. Discount Percentage: Set the percentage discount on the selling price. Minimum Sales Requirement: Specify the condition for discount application. Validity Period: Define the start and end dates for the discount rules. Promotional Text: Add promotional text to promote the discounts effectively. Coupon Settings (Advanced Version) Discount Percentage: Set the discount percentage for the selling price. Coupon Code: Enter a valid coupon code for discounts. Validity Period: Specify the start and end dates for coupon validity. From the version v5.0.74, was included an add-on to allow generate coupons dynamically with every purchase, and send them to the buyers to promote new purchases. Coupons Generator Add-On (Advanced Version) Activate the Coupons Generator: Enable the coupon generator feature. Discount Percentage: Set the discount percentage for generated coupons. Coupon Code Length: Define the number of characters in the coupon codes. Validity Period: Specify the number of days the coupons are valid. Promotional Message: Add a promotional message to notification emails with coupon details. Notification Settings for Buyers and Store Managers Sender Email Address: Email displayed as the sender of notifications. Notification Email Address: Email where notifications are sent after each sale. User Confirmation Email Subject: Subject line for customer purchase confirmation email. User Confirmation Email Body: Message sent to the client upon purchase, with %INFORMATION% tag replaced by purchase data. Admin Notification Email Subject: Subject line for administrator notification on purchase. Admin Notification Email Body: Message sent to the administrator on purchase, with %INFORMATION% tag replaced by purchase data. Note: Salesforce requires at least the users emails to create the leads. Creating content Two types of products can be sold through the Music Store – WordPress ecommerce: songs or collections. Creating songs Click on “Music Store Song” in the menu to add a new song. Fill in the following details for the song: Title: Enter the song title. Description: Optional information about the song. Sales Price: Price of the song. Exclusive Price: Price for exclusive sales. Single Sale: Check to sell the song individually. Audio File for Sale: URL of the audio file. Audio File for Demo: URL of the demo audio file. Protect File: Secure playback to prevent downloading (Professional plugin version). Artist: Choose the artist(s) or add a new one. Album: Select the album(s) where the song is included or add a new one. Cover: URL of the cover image. Duration: Song length. Publication Year: Year of release. Additional Information: URL for more details about the song. To set discounts: New Price: Discounted price. Valid from: Start date of the discount. Valid to: End date of the discount. Promotional Text: Text to promote the discount. On the right side, you can specify the song’s genre. Creating collections Click on “Music Store Collection” in the menu to access the collection section. Click “Add New” to create a new collection. Collection setup interface: Title: Enter the collection title. Description: Optional description of the collection. Sales Price: Price of the collection. Exclusive Price: Price for exclusive sales (removes collection from store). Songs in Collection: Choose songs to include in the collection. Songs must be public and defined in the songs section. Artist: Select the artist(s) for the collection or add a new one. Cover: URL of the cover image. Publication Year: Year of release for the collection. Additional Information: URL for more details about the collection. To set discounts: New Price: Discounted price. Valid from: Start date of the discount. Valid to: End date of the discount. Promotional Text: Text to promote the discount. On the right side, you can specify the genre of the collection. Publishing the Music Store – WordPress ecommerce To add the Music Store to a page or post on your WordPress site, follow these steps: Navigate to the page or post where you want to display the Music Store, or create a new page/post. Insert the Music Store block Interface for inserting the Music Store in WordPress ecommerce: Filter results by product type: By default, shows products of a specific type. Columns: Set the number of columns for displaying store products. Filter results by genre: Filter products by genre. Filter results by artist: Filter products by artist. Filter results by album: Filter products by album. The insertion process will generate a shortcode that will be replaced by the Music Store when it is viewed on the website. To add the Music Store to a post or page, use the shortcode [music_store column="3"]. If you prefer to insert the Music Store directly into the template, use the following PHP code: Interface for insertion dialog of product list in a page or post (the interface is available as a widget for inserting the products list in the website’s sidebars) Select the type of products list (top rated products, the newest products, or the top selling). Enter the number of products to display on list. Enter the number of columns(if the products list is inserted in a website’s sidebar, it is recommended to use only one column). The insertion process generates a shortcode which will be replaced by the products list when page is displayed on the website. The shortcode in a post or page has the structure: [music_store_product_list columns="1" number="3" type="top_rated"] If prefer to insert the product directly in template: Interface for insertion dialog of sales counter in a page or post (the interface is available as a widget for inserting the counter in the website’s sidebars) Select the numbers design. Enter the minimum length of counter number. The insertion process generates a shortcode which will be replaced by the counter when page is displayed on the website. The shortcode in a post or page has the structure: [music_store_sales_counter min_length="3" style="alt_digits"] If prefer to insert the product directly in template: Purchased Products List The [music_store_purchased_list] shortcode is replaced by the list of products purchased by the logged user. Sale Statistics When a sale occurs, the Music Store administrator receives a notification email. Additionally, sales can be managed and reviewed in the Sales Reports section. To access this feature, follow these steps: Navigate to the store’s setup page by going to “Music Store / Sales Report” menu option (refer to screenshot-9). In the Reports section, you can: Filter sales reports for a specific period (defaults to the current day). View total sales for the selected period and the currency used for the sales (refer to screenshot-10). Generate charts with graphical data on sales, such as sales by country, currency, and products. You can also: Delete a sales report from the list, useful for refunds to buyers and keeping sales statistics accurate. Replace all purchases associated with an email address with another email address. Additionally, you have the option to manually enter sales entries, enabling website owners to update sales reports even for products sold through other channels. WooCommerce is the open-source ecommerce platform for WordPress. Our core platform is free, flexible, and amplified by a global community. The freedom of open-source means you retain full ownership of your store’s content and data forever. Whether you’re launching a business, taking brick-and-mortar retail online, or developing sites for clients, use WooCommerce for a store that powerfully blends content and commerce. Create beautiful, enticing storefronts with themes suited to your brand and industry. Increase revenue with an optimized shopping cart experience that converts. Customize product pages in minutes using modular product blocks. Showcase physical and digital goods, product variations, custom configurations, instant downloads, and affiliate items. Sell subscriptions, bookings, or memberships, with our developer-vetted extensions. Rise to the top of search results by leveraging WordPress’ SEO advantage. Build on a platform that scales.
